Abstract

Liquid–liquid equilibrium (LLE) data of ternary mixtures containing n-hexane, benzene and acetonitrile were measured at T = (298.15, 308.15 and 318.15) K under atmospheric pressure, respectively. The reliability of the experimental data was checked by Othmer–Tobias, Bachman and Hand correlations. Both the NRTL and UNIQUAC models were used to correlate the LLE data and the binary interaction parameters were obtained valid for the range of temperature studied. The two models correlated the LLE data well, and the NRTL model gave slightly better predicted results than UNIQUAC. The measured data can be used to design and optimize the separation process of benzene + acetonitrile system by azeotropic distillation method with n-hexane as entrainer.
